Central AC installation by home size: Miramar vs St. Petersburg
Central AC is sized in tons of cooling — about one ton per 500–600 sq ft. Undersizing leaves you hot; oversizing short-cycles and wastes money, so a Manual J load calculation matters.

Cheapest time for central AC installation in either city
Crews are busiest — and priciest — exactly when it's hottest or coldest, since that's when systems fail under load. Book in the mild months and you're negotiating from a position of choice, not a broken furnace.
How much should you really budget for HVAC in 2026?
Get the sizing wrong or the efficiency tier mismatched to your climate, and the price drifts fast in either direction. Below, a look at how those choices — plus brand markup — shape the real number.
The budget-first case
Run a Manual J load calculation, then buy the standard tier — 80% AFUE, 14.3 SEER2 — and stop there. Where summers are short and winters are gentle, the equipment idles most of the year, so premium efficiency never gets enough runtime to earn back its price. Paying for SEER2 you'll rarely tap is the classic way a mild-climate homeowner overspends.
The efficiency-first case
Where you face brutal summers or hard winters, a higher SEER2/AFUE system or a heat pump runs enough hours to claw back its premium through lower bills — and utility or state rebates can still trim the sticker even though the federal 25C/25D credits closed at the end of 2025. Do the payback arithmetic before you reach for the cheapest box on the lot.
The longevity case
Brand is a footnote; sizing and install quality write the story. A right-sized mid-tier system that's properly commissioned and serviced once a year will outlive an oversized premium unit that short-cycles itself to an early grave. Put the money into the crew and the setup rather than the nameplate.
The brand on the unit matters far less than getting the sizing and installation right. Insist on a Manual J calculation, match efficiency to your climate, and claim every rebate available.
